The thing is, the way it works is if it's not in the original source, then it's classified as filler. Even if it was something intended to be in the original source but was cut. For example the Bleach filler arc in Hueco Mundo about Ashido Kano was supposedly intended to be in the manga but was cut as well yet the arc is still considered filler.

The thing about One Piece fillers, is even the worst of them just about feel like canon, unlike any other show, so it's extremely hard to differentiate unless you look it up or have read the manga. You can probably classify this episode as both canon and filler if you wanted to, but the general term would still be filler.
